Scholarship Review Process

The Scholarships360 Research Team reviews all scholarships individually and strives to exclude any scholarship where any of the below applies:

  • The scholarship requires a fee to apply
  • The scholarship provider’s privacy policy allows for the misuse of student data
  • The scholarship requires paid membership in an organization (with certain exceptions for reputable trade organizations and others)
  • Student are required to sign up for a site or service to apply*
  • The scholarship seems primarily used for lead generation** or idea harvesting purposes***
  • The scholarship website has many grammatical errors and/or advertisements
  • The scholarship or scholarship providing organization seem untrustworthy
  • There is no evidence the scholarship was previously awarded
  • The scholarship has not been awarded in the past 12 months
  • There is no available contact information

If you believe a scholarship has been published in error, please reach out to [email protected] and we’ll take a look!


* There are certain exceptions to this, for example if the sponsoring organization is a major corporation or nonprofit with its own scholarship application system.
** Lead generation scholarships will require students to sign up for an app or website and require minimal (if any) application requirements.
***Idea harvesting scholarships will require students to submit blog posts or other materials that companies may use for marketing purposes.

Garden Club of America Board of Associates Centennial Pollinator Fellowship
Garden Club of America Board of Associates Centennial Pollinator Fellowship

Offered by Garden Club of America

1 award worth $4,000
Deadline Jan 15, 2024

The Garden Club of America Board of Associates Centennial Pollinator Fellowship provides funding to study the causes of pollinator decline, in particular bees, bats, butterflies…

The Garden Club of America Board of Associates Centennial Pollinator Fellowship provides funding to study the causes of pollinator decline, in particular bees, bats, butterflies…

The Garden Club of America Board of Associates Centennial Pollinator Fellowship provides funding to study the causes of pollinator decline, in particular bees, bats, butterflies and moths, which could lead to potential solutions for their conservation and sustainability. It is awarded to one or more current graduate students enrolled in U.S. institutions. A recipient may reapply for an additional year of funding. Please visit the scholarship's website for the full list of research categories that students may apply to. GCA fellows will provide an interim 250-word report, two high quality photos, and an expense summary to GCA and P2. A final report and final expense summary is also required. If you're a graduate student with a passion for studying the causes of pollinator decline, we encourage you to apply! Keep on reading to learn more.

Sara Shallenberger Brown Garden Club of America National Parks Conservation Scholarship
Sara Shallenberger Brown Garden Club of America National Parks Conservation Scholarship

Offered by Garden Club of America

Multiple awards worth $250
Deadline Feb 1, 2024

The Sara Shallenberger Brown Garden Club of America National Parks Conservation Scholarship is an incredible opportunity for college undergraduates aged 19 to 20 to gain…

The Sara Shallenberger Brown Garden Club of America National Parks Conservation Scholarship is an incredible opportunity for college undergraduates aged 19 to 20 to gain…

The Sara Shallenberger Brown Garden Club of America National Parks Conservation Scholarship is an incredible opportunity for college undergraduates aged 19 to 20 to gain technical and personal skills, as well as field experience, in the conservation fields. This scholarship aims to encourage studies and careers in conservation, with a focus on protecting and enhancing the U.S. National Parks for lasting benefit. The selected student will become a future leader in challenging and rewarding conservation service work. Eligibility is open to U.S. Citizens and permanent residents enrolled in a U.S.-based institution, with preference given to those with prior SCA experience. The scholarship provides training, transportation, and a $250/wk stipend for each student as an SCA apprentice crew leader working directly under two experienced leaders on a 3 or 4 week summer trail crew in one of America’s storied national parks. Apply to become a part of this incredible opportunity!

American Ground Water Trust-Thomas Stetson Scholarship
American Ground Water Trust-Thomas Stetson Scholarship

Offered by American Ground Water Trust

1 award worth $2,000
Deadline Jun 30, 2024

The Thomas M. Stetson Scholarship annually awards $2,000 to an incoming freshman who will be enrolled full-time in a ground-water-related field of study at a…

The Thomas M. Stetson Scholarship annually awards $2,000 to an incoming freshman who will be enrolled full-time in a ground-water-related field of study at a…

The Thomas M. Stetson Scholarship annually awards $2,000 to an incoming freshman who will be enrolled full-time in a ground-water-related field of study at a four-year accredited university in the U.S. To be eligible, applicants must either have completed a science/environmental project at high school that directly involved groundwater resources or, have had vacation/out-of-school work experience that is related to the environment and natural resources. This scholarship is given in recognition of the life-long contributions of Mr. Stetson to solving water resource conflicts and developing sustainable water management methods in the Western United States. If you're an incoming college freshman who will be pursuing a course of study in a groundwater-related field, we encourage you to apply! Keep on reading to learn more.
